A review of business failures as described in the financial press, such as the Wall Street Journal, suggests that the control environment is one of the major contributors to the failure. Often the tone at the top at the failed companies reflects a disdain for controls and an emphasis on accomplishing specific financial reporting objectives such as reporting increased profitability. How will the auditors assessment of the operating effectiveness of the control environment affect the design and conduct of an audit? Consider both a positive and negative assessment.
